Android Software Engineer I at Global Payments

Cuajimalpa de Morelos, Mexico City, Mexico

Global Payments Logo
Not SpecifiedCompensation
Junior (1 to 2 years)Experience Level
Full TimeJob Type
UnknownVisa
FinTech, PaymentsIndustries

Requirements

  • Bachelor’s degree (or equivalent) in Computer Science, Engineering, or a related field
  • Demonstrated experience with Android programming
  • Proficiency in Java and Android development
  • Experience with Global Payments’ technologies is a plus
  • Excellent oral and written communication skills
  • Strong work ethic and commitment to excellence
  • Ability to work effectively in a collaborative, agile team environment
  • Excellent problem-solving skills

Responsibilities

  • Code and unit test assigned tasks
  • Work with the QA team to develop test cases and execute them in the development environment
  • Revise design documents and test cases to ensure accuracy before delivering work to QA
  • Assist the Enterprise Integrations team in troubleshooting client issues and providing solutions
  • Participate in design meetings with management and the support team to develop solutions
  • Daily participation in Team Stand-Ups and Scrum Ceremonies (Planning Sessions, Retrospectives)
  • Research and discuss new technologies with the management team and propose their implementation (subject to approval)
  • Assist in preparing scope, levels of effort, and estimates
  • Create and maintain technical documentation, work breakdowns, and development estimates
  • Gather information from internal and external resources for documentation and task completion
  • Develop design documents, task breakdowns, and task estimates for assigned work
  • Foster a collaborative environment and support team goals
  • Continue professional development through ongoing learning (books, seminars, training)
  • Provide emergency support after hours as needed

Skills

Key technologies and capabilities for this role

AndroidUnit TestingScrumAgileTechnical DocumentationTroubleshootingTest CasesDesign Documents

Questions & Answers

Common questions about this position

What is the salary for the Android Software Engineer I position?

This information is not specified in the job description.

Is this Android Software Engineer role remote or office-based?

This information is not specified in the job description.

What skills are required for this Android Software Engineer position?

Required skills include a Bachelor’s degree in Computer Science or related field, demonstrated experience with Android programming, proficiency in Java and Android development, excellent communication skills, strong work ethic, ability to work in a collaborative agile team, and excellent problem-solving skills.

What is the team structure and work environment like for this role?

The role involves daily participation in Team Stand-Ups and Scrum Ceremonies, working with the QA team, Enterprise Integrations team, management, and support team in a collaborative, agile environment.

What makes a strong candidate for the Android Software Engineer I role?

Strong candidates have a Bachelor’s degree in Computer Science or related field, proficiency in Java and Android development, experience in agile teams, excellent problem-solving and communication skills, and a strong work ethic; experience with Global Payments’ technologies is a plus.

Global Payments

Payment technologies and software solutions

About Global Payments

N/AHeadquarters
N/AYear Founded
N/ACompany Stage

Land your dream remote job 3x faster with AI